ARLESEY SIGN OFF ON A HIGH

PETERSFIELD 2 ARLESEY TN 3
By Gideon Mead
ARLESEY TOWN made sure to sign off their campaign on a high after beating bottom side Petersfield Town.
With little but pride to play for, it was visiting team Arlesey who took the lead on ten minutes through Tony Williams.
But Petersfield were keen to play their part too and levelled just seven minutes later via Adam Cripps.
A lively start continued at pace with Arel Amu making it 2-1 on 25 minutes.
